Professional Ramp Design and Installation Process
King Construction combines structural engineering expertise with precision concrete work to ensure a safe, functional, and durable result.
- Site Evaluation – Assessment of elevation, dock height, truck bed clearances, and spatial layout.
- Design Development – CAD-based planning for proper slope ratios, reinforcement, and transitions to dock or garage flooring.
- Formwork and Pouring – High-strength concrete placement with steel mesh reinforcement for long life.
- Finishing and Curing – Textured surface treatment for traction, drainage optimization, and edge protection.
- Inspection and Safety Verification – Testing for grade, load capacity, and accessibility compliance before completion.
